This time, the monsoon rains have failed in North Karnataka, and agricultural activities have been severely hampered due to lack of rain. The sown crops have reached the stage of drying up without water, and farmers are facing serious difficulties. The condition of the food grains is becoming difficult day by day due to the cost of sowing, water scarcity and weather anomalies. This time, the monsoon has brought disappointment to the farmers who were expecting rain.
